Stewed Cauliflower In Cream Sauce

  Raciónes: 4

Ingredientes

  • 2 c. Cauliflower florets
  • 1/2 c. Unpeeled canned straw mushrooms
  • 3 x Green onions
  • 1 x Clove garlic, smashed
  • 1 tsp Tientsin cabbage
  •     Shrimp or possibly crab meat (opt)
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• 1 tsp Sugar
  • 2 Tbsp. Peanut oil
  • 1/2 tsp Peanut oil
  •     Cornstarch paste
  • 2/3 c. Stock
  • 1 tsp Dry sherry
  • 1/4 c. Lowfat milk

Direcciones

  1. Preparation: Wash cauliflower, and cut florets about twice the size of straw mushrooms. Dice green onions into 1/4" pcs. Mix stock & sherry.
  2. Cooking: Heat first oil to medium warm. Add in garlic & stir for about 30 seconds. Remove garlic before it begins to brown. Turn heat high; add in cauliflower. Stir-fry for about 1 minute. Add in onion, salt & sugar; stir-fry 30 seconds. Stir in Tientsin cabbage. If you like, add in shrimp or possibly crab meat. Immediately add in stock & sherry; bring sauce to boil, mixing with cauliflower. Cover & simmer 4 min. Remove lid; thicken with cornstarch. Sauce should be very heavy, so which when lowfat milk is added, it will thin slightly, but still have body. Bring sauce back to boil; slowly add in lowfat milk while stirring. Add in remaining peanut oil for a final glaze.
  3. Serve.
